Why it’s time we supported our own

THE trouble with Cork is there’s just too much music.

Why it’s time we supported our own

Any night of the week there’s something unmissable, usually two or three concerts, not to mention rehearsals or launches where a body should be at. It’s a huge privilege to be a music fan in Cork city in recent decades.

Cork’s music scene is an ever-shifting ecosystem, with talent blown in from far flung lands and locally produced gems borne away on the tides. Music is what brought many of us to the city, and what convinced many more to stay.
